Startup intention of university students in the economic sector in Hanoi using structural equation modeling
View through CrossRef
Purpose - This article investigates the startup intention of 316 students in six universities in the economic sector, which are at the top in terms of training scale and number of training disciplines in Hanoi, Vietnam.
Design/methodology/approach - The study considered the groups of external factors that have impacts on startups in addition to two of the three directed factors of the Theory of Planned Behavior (TPB), which are higher education programs and financial support from the university. The study was conducted by utilizing quantitative research to measure the structural relationship among various proposed latent variables using the partial least squares method. SmartPLS 3.0 software was applied to analyze and verify the gathered data, and the proposed hypothesis model.
Findings - The findings reveal that the startup intention questionnaire was found to be a valid instrument for measuring the startup intention of university students in the economic sector in Ha Noi. The result of path analysis indicates that all these variables have a positive effect on startup intention. Additionally, the direct effect of attitude toward the act to startup, perceived feasibility, higher education program, financial support, and startup intention has a significant positive effect on strategy alignment. These results help policymakers build the appropriate educational environment to foster students’ startup and develop a startup ecosystem.
Implications - Overall, this study implies that many factors can influence students’ startup intentions. Policymakers can use the results to build the appropriate educational environment to foster students’ startups and develop a startup ecosystem.
Originality/value - This paper is the first empirical study that critically investigates the startup intention of students in the top six universities in the economic sector.
